Ive found a great blog. The art of manliness.
“Welcome to The Art of Manliness- a blog dedicated to uncovering the lost art of being a man.
The Art of Manliness is authored by husband and wife team, Brett and Kate McKay. It features articles on helping men be better husbands, better fathers, and better men. In our search to uncover the lost art of manliness, we’ll look to the past to find examples of manliness in action. We’ll analyze the lives of great men who knew what it meant to “man up” and hopefully learn from them. Every week we seek to uncover the essential skills and knowledge today’s man needs to know. Since beginning in January 2008, The Art of Manliness has already gained 17,000+ subscribers and continues to grow each wee”
They have written entries about the history of male friendship, Are the suburbs killing your manhood?, 100 Must-read books: The essential man’s library, the mechanics of the man-hug and 9 ways to start a fire without matches
